sf: Change interface definition methodology (#1074)

* sf: Begin experimenting with new interface declaration format

* sf: convert fs interfaces to new format

* sf: finish conversion of libstrat to new definitions

* sf: convert loader to new format

* sf: convert spl to new format

* sf: update ncm for new format

* sf: convert pm to new format

* sf: convert ro/sm to new format

* sf: update fatal for new format

* sf: support building dmnt under new scheme

* sf: update ams.mitm for new format

* sf: correct invocation def for pointer holder

* fs: correct 10.x+ user bindings for Get*SpaceSize

#include <stratosphere.hpp>
#include "ro_ro_service.hpp"
#include "impl/ro_service_impl.hpp"
namespace ams::ro {
void SetDevelopmentHardware(bool is_development_hardware) {
impl::SetDevelopmentHardware(is_development_hardware);
}
void SetDevelopmentFunctionEnabled(bool is_development_function_enabled) {
impl::SetDevelopmentFunctionEnabled(is_development_function_enabled);
}
RoService::RoService(ModuleType t) : context_id(impl::InvalidContextId), type(t) {
/* ... */
}
RoService::~RoService() {
impl::UnregisterProcess(this->context_id);
}
Result RoService::MapManualLoadModuleMemory(sf::Out<u64> load_address, const sf::ClientProcessId &client_pid, u64 nro_address, u64 nro_size, u64 bss_address, u64 bss_size) {
R_TRY(impl::ValidateProcess(this->context_id, client_pid.GetValue()));
return impl::MapManualLoadModuleMemory(load_address.GetPointer(), this->context_id, nro_address, nro_size, bss_address, bss_size);
}
Result RoService::UnmapManualLoadModuleMemory(const sf::ClientProcessId &client_pid, u64 nro_address) {
R_TRY(impl::ValidateProcess(this->context_id, client_pid.GetValue()));
return impl::UnmapManualLoadModuleMemory(this->context_id, nro_address);
}
Result RoService::RegisterModuleInfo(const sf::ClientProcessId &client_pid, u64 nrr_address, u64 nrr_size) {
R_TRY(impl::ValidateProcess(this->context_id, client_pid.GetValue()));
return impl::RegisterModuleInfo(this->context_id, svc::InvalidHandle, nrr_address, nrr_size, ModuleType::ForSelf, true);
}
Result RoService::UnregisterModuleInfo(const sf::ClientProcessId &client_pid, u64 nrr_address) {
R_TRY(impl::ValidateProcess(this->context_id, client_pid.GetValue()));
return impl::UnregisterModuleInfo(this->context_id, nrr_address);
}
Result RoService::RegisterProcessHandle(const sf::ClientProcessId &client_pid, sf::CopyHandle process_h) {
return impl::RegisterProcess(std::addressof(this->context_id), process_h.GetValue(), client_pid.GetValue());
}
Result RoService::RegisterModuleInfoEx(const sf::ClientProcessId &client_pid, u64 nrr_address, u64 nrr_size, sf::CopyHandle process_h) {
R_TRY(impl::ValidateProcess(this->context_id, client_pid.GetValue()));
return impl::RegisterModuleInfo(this->context_id, process_h.GetValue(), nrr_address, nrr_size, this->type, this->type == ModuleType::ForOthers);
}
}

#pragma once
#include <stratosphere.hpp>
namespace ams::ro {
/* Access utilities. */
void SetDevelopmentHardware(bool is_development_hardware);
void SetDevelopmentFunctionEnabled(bool is_development_function_enabled);
class RoService {
private:
size_t context_id;
ModuleType type;
protected:
explicit RoService(ModuleType t);
public:
virtual ~RoService();
public:
/* Actual commands. */
Result MapManualLoadModuleMemory(sf::Out<u64> out_load_address, const sf::ClientProcessId &client_pid, u64 nro_address, u64 nro_size, u64 bss_address, u64 bss_size);
Result UnmapManualLoadModuleMemory(const sf::ClientProcessId &client_pid, u64 nro_address);
Result RegisterModuleInfo(const sf::ClientProcessId &client_pid, u64 nrr_address, u64 nrr_size);
Result UnregisterModuleInfo(const sf::ClientProcessId &client_pid, u64 nrr_address);
Result RegisterProcessHandle(const sf::ClientProcessId &client_pid, sf::CopyHandle process_h);
Result RegisterModuleInfoEx(const sf::ClientProcessId &client_pid, u64 nrr_address, u64 nrr_size, sf::CopyHandle process_h);
};
static_assert(ro::impl::IsIRoInterface<RoService>);
class RoServiceForSelf final : public RoService {
public:
RoServiceForSelf() : RoService(ro::ModuleType::ForSelf) { /* ... */ }
};
/* TODO: This is really JitPlugin... */
class RoServiceForOthers final : public RoService {
public:
RoServiceForOthers() : RoService(ro::ModuleType::ForOthers) { /* ... */ }
};
}
